What are the responsibilities and job description for the Associate Manager, Memberships position at Amneal?
Description:
The overall responsibilities of the Associate Manager, Memberships are to provide supervision, training, and development to the Membership Analysts, in the US and India, for Amneal and AvKare, and to provide support to the Associate Manager, Memberships and Membership. This position also aids in customer response regarding contract set up at wholesalers and any chargeback eligibility discrepancies. The position is also responsible for protecting the Company's financial interests through ongoing review of key controls to ensure valid pricing is provided to customers and appropriate payments are made to wholesalers.
The Associate Manager, Memberships will manage the creation and maintenance of our customers in our Flex system, which will provide pricing alignment to our new Amneal Direct to Customer software and will provide support to all Amneal Business segments (Generics, Biosciences, Biosimilars, BD, etc.). In addition, the position is responsible for ensuring that consistent and appropriate Class of Trade (COT) assignments are selected and entered into the Flex contract management system, which will feed the new Amneal Customer Master system.
The Associate Manager, Memberships will also be required to be a super user of the Model-N Flex system and be capable of delivering effective training to direct reports as well as support staff in India. The Associate Manager is also responsible to ensure SOX compliance and effectiveness of internal control procedures, policies and Amneal Work Instructions that govern the processing of contract memberships, member maintenance, member COT assignments that drive our government price calculations, as well as chargeback processing in the Flex system.
Essential Functions:
- Set team goals, provide management in the day-to-day functions, mentor, develop and train associates as needed and ensure the Amneal US and India Membership Analysts have the tools to excel in their roles. Manage the set-up, COT assignments, wholesaler contract set up and customer membership disputes for Amneal and AvKare. Manage the day-to-day workload of team members and reallocate workload as appropriate. Review contract language in order determine the most effective way to set up eligibility sets for contracts. Participates in inter-department meetings to ensure contract language regarding membership is appropriate. Ensure all processes are compliant with SOX and department work instructions.
- Researches and resolves issues involving chargeback membership discrepancies and works closely with the contract administration team to ensure correct eligibility sets are attached to pricing so that chargebacks may be properly paid or effectively disputed. Reviews historical deductions to determine if reprocessing is warranted based on subsequent master data updates.
- Communicates with customers to effectively resolve disputes, coordinate system testing and improve communication to ensure contracts membership is correctly set up at the wholesalers to provide accurate invoicing to customers and timely chargeback processing.
- Partner with Accounts Receivable team regarding open chargeback deductions and ongoing account reconciliation.
- Act as superuser for the Model N and AMM systems. Review quarterly release notes to determine appropriateness and usefulness of any proposed changes. Partner with IT to implement any updates.
